Understanding LLCs
Limited Liability Companies, commonly referred to as LLCs, are a favored business structure in the U.S.. They provide the advantages of liability protection like corporations while maintaining the agility and tax benefits of a partnership. This implies that the personal assets of the owners, called members, are generally safeguarded from business debts and obligations. As a result, LLCs draw in many entrepreneurs seeking to minimize individual risk while enjoying operational maneuverability.
One of the primary attractions of an Limited Liability Company is its pass-through taxation aspect. This permits profits and losses to be declared on the members' individual tax filings, preventing the double taxation that often impacts traditional corporate entities. Furthermore, forming an LLC is a simple procedure, which typically involves filing articles of organization with the jurisdiction and paying a minimal charge. For those not acquainted with the process, an Limited Liability Company business name search can assist in finding out if the desired company name is available and ensure adherence with local laws.

How to Perform a LLC Lookup
Executing a Limited Liability Company search is a vital measure to startups seeking to start or investigate their enterprise. To begin, establish the specific state where the LLC has been established, since business entities are governed under local regulations. Each state's Secretary of State website generally features a business entity lookup function, that allows you to find LLCs using the name and using the official title. Input the relevant data to fetch information about the LLC, such as its formation time, standing, and at times also the business endeavors.
Next, think about utilizing wider tools and databases that feature a USA company lookup feature. Such platforms aggregate information from different states, providing an more complete perspective of your desired LLC as well as its related organizations. It can be especially advantageous when you're considering partnerships, funding, or industry exploration. Verify you examine multiple references to check the information, as variations may sometimes happen in local records versus web-based databases.

Frequent Difficulties in LLC Investigations
One frequent issue in LLC investigations is the discrepancy of business names across different states. Numerous entrepreneurs register their LLCs in one state but may operate in additional states, leading to potential confusion during an LLC business search. As you are trying to find a specific business, variations in spelling or additional identifiers can make it challenging to locate the correct entity. This can be particularly problematic if the names are prevalent, resulting in numerous entities showing up in a business entity search.
An additional issue is the varying state regulations and criteria regarding LLC data. Each state has its own guidelines about what information must be disclosed and how often it must be revised. Some states may not require a complete database for public access, making it harder to conduct a thorough USA business search. This lack of consistency can hinder both entrepreneurs and consumers from efficiently verifying the legitimacy and status of a business.

Best Practices for LLC Name Verification
As you start forming an LLC, your first task is confirming your desired name is distinct and in accordance with state regulations. Performing an LLC name search is crucial to find out if your desired name is already in use or too similar to another registered entity. Naming rules differ by state, including restrictions on particular vocabulary and mandatory designators, such as LLC or Limited Liability Company. Make use of the LLC company search tools accessible online meant for your state to streamline this process.
Once you've verified your name is unclaimed through an LLC search, consider holding it for a set duration. Many states enable you to set aside an LLC name to guarantee it stays yours while you complete the remaining requirements to establish your company. This can be beneficial if you anticipate delays in registration or need more time to complete your business plan. It is advisable to request a name reservation as soon as possible to minimize any potential conflicts that could arise.
